Seek Breastfeeding Help From Professionals

As a first-time mother, you might be quite unaware of the techniques and intricacies of breastfeeding and in such a situation breastfeeding help can be a good source of much needed information. You can get proper advice regarding many aspects of breastfeeding such as how to take care of the baby, the right time to feed it, what type of feed you should take, when you should go to sleep and what to feed the baby if you run out of milk. Breastfeeding help would be ideal when you are exhausted after the birth of the baby. You would also gain immensely from the advice of lactation consultants at this stage.

Lactation consultants are available either in hospitals or in the office of a pediatrician. They also work privately and it is advisable for first time mothers to consult them shortly after the birth of the baby so that proper breastfeeding techniques are adopted from the very beginning. It is essential to know about latch-on basics but merely reading text and seeing pictures might not be of great help. Instead, if voluntary breastfeeding counselors show you the techniques practically, you would be in a much better position to feed your baby properly and also avoid latch-on problems such as sore nipples and the baby getting less milk. Lactation services are also provided by many hospitals as a component of their maternity schemes.

Lactation consultants can provide proper breastfeeding help and breastfeeding tips if your baby finds it difficult to latch-on or suck or if some other medical problems are making it difficult for the baby to breastfeed. All that you need to do is to look around, make some queries and find a good and experienced lactation expert. You can take the help of your childbirth educator, or the health care provider for finding the best lactation consultant in your area. It’s important to check the credentials of the lactation consultant and you should look for the credentials IBCLC (international board certified lactation consultant) or CLC (certified lactation consultant) after the name.

Many nursing mothers get specific problems regarding breastfeeding. These problems need special devices such as pumps or breast shells to facilitate the discharge of the milk. A lactation consultant is the best person who can guide the mother on the proper use of the breastfeeding pump and how to eliminate the problem that created the need for the external device.

There are many volunteer organizations like La Leche Volunteers that provide breastfeeding help either on the telephone or through support meetings. Many leaflets and books are also published by them to provide breastfeeding help to the mothers and to give all possible information and support to the mothers who can gain sufficient confidence and practical knowledge. By attending the monthly meetings, the mothers can interact with each other and exchange notes based on their personal experiences. Moreover, the mothers can gain proper knowledge regarding positioning of the baby near the breast, public place breastfeeding and general tips regarding mothering.
